What does the number in the bottom corner of a placard represent?

a.The hazard class or division number
b.The truck's license plate number
c.The delivery zip code
d.The number of packages

Explicación

The number at the bottom of a placard identifies the hazard class or division of the material, such as 3 for flammable liquid or 8 for corrosive. This helps responders quickly understand the hazard. The class number works with the color and symbol on the placard.
